Description
An attractive owner occupied 3/4 bedroom, 2 bathroom, Ashlar stone fronted Victorian mid-terraced house, arranged over three levels with flexible accommodation, large conservatory and rear courtyard gardens.
Presented to an owner occupied standard, providing flexible accommodation and a pair of alternative entrances from the front.
Gas fired central heating and fully double glazed throughout.
A substantial rear conservatory leading from the kitchen.
Built-in wardrobes in all bedrooms on the upper floors.
Prime location in the heart of Redland, equidistant between Whiteladies Road and Gloucester Road, with the lovely independent shops, restaurants and cafes of Chandos Road on the doorstep. Local schools include St John's Primary, Cotham Gardens Primary and Cotham Secondary School, making it a great location for young professionals and families alike.
Situated in the Cotham and Redland Conservation Area and the CN residents parking scheme.

INFORMAL TENDER
Please note this property is being sold by informal tender, a property sale method where potential buyers are requested to submit sealed bids by a specific deadline, similar in nature to best and final offers/sealed bids. Bids requested to be made before 9am on Tuesday 18th November. As with a typical private treaty sale, all offers are subject to contract.
